Corthe Dermo Pure First Aid Cleansing Foam is a gently exfoliating whipped cleanser built for skin that produces excess oil and struggles with congestion. It lifts away sebum and surface impurities without stripping moisture, leaving skin feeling clean, balanced, and comfortable rather than tight or dry. Botanical extracts like calendula and chamomile keep the formula soothing enough for daily use.
Key Benefits
Clears Congestion and Refines Pores: Salicylic acid works inside the pore lining to dissolve the oil and debris that lead to breakouts, helping keep pores visibly smaller and less prone to clogging.
Smooths Skin Texture Through Gentle Enzymatic Exfoliation: Saccharomyces ferment provides a mild enzymatic action that breaks down dull, dead surface cells so skin looks and feels noticeably smoother after each wash.
Protects Against Environmental Stress: Cryptomeria japonica leaf extract delivers antioxidant support that helps neutralize free radicals picked up from pollution and daily environmental exposure.
Soothes and Calms Reactive Skin: Allantoin, calendula flower extract, and chamomile flower extract work together to reduce irritation and redness, making this foam gentle enough for sensitized, breakout-prone skin.
Maintains Moisture Balance: Glycerin draws water into the outer layers of skin while beeswax and glyceryl stearate help preserve the moisture barrier, so skin stays hydrated even after cleansing.

Spend the full 60 seconds massaging this foam into your skin rather than rushing the rinse. That contact time allows the salicylic acid and saccharomyces ferment to do their best work on congestion and texture, especially around the nose and chin where buildup tends to concentrate.
-
Apply: Dispense a dime-sized amount onto damp hands and work into a lather.
Technique: Massage the foam over your face using gentle circular motions for up to one minute, focusing on oily or congested areas like the nose, chin, and forehead.
Remove: Rinse thoroughly with lukewarm water and pat dry.
Frequency: Use morning and evening as your daily cleanser, or once daily if your skin is on the drier or more sensitive side.

What skin types is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am best suited for?
It is formulated primarily for oily and combination skin types that are prone to congestion, enlarged pores, and breakouts. The salicylic acid and enzymatic exfoliation target excess oil and buildup, while soothing botanicals make it gentle enough for sensitized skin. If your skin is very dry, a non-foaming or cream-based cleanser may be a better fit.
Can I use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am every day?
Yes, it is designed for daily use. Most people with oily or combination skin can use it both morning and evening. If your skin feels slightly tight after cleansing, scale back to once daily, ideally in the evening, to remove the day's oil and impurities.
Does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am help with blackheads?
It does. Salicylic acid is oil-soluble, which means it can penetrate into the pore lining to dissolve the sebum plugs that form blackheads. Consistent daily use helps prevent new blackheads from forming and gradually clears existing ones.
Will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am dry out my skin?
The formula includes glycerin and beeswax to help maintain moisture balance during cleansing, so it should not leave skin feeling stripped or tight. Allantoin and soothing flower extracts further reduce any potential for irritation. That said, always follow with a moisturizer suited to your skin type.
What does saccharomyces ferment do in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am?
Saccharomyces ferment is a yeast-derived ingredient that provides gentle enzymatic exfoliation. It helps break down dead skin cells on the surface, improving texture and clarity without the abrasiveness of physical scrubs. This makes it a good option for skin that is both congested and easily irritated.
Can I use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am with a retinol product in my routine?
Yes, it pairs well with retinol routines. Because the cleanser contains a mild level of salicylic acid and enzymatic exfoliation, it provides a clean canvas that helps your retinol absorb more effectively. If you notice any increased sensitivity, reduce use to once daily and monitor how your skin responds.
Is Corthe First Aid Cleansing Foam safe for acne-prone skin?
Absolutely. Salicylic acid is one of the most widely recommended ingredients for acne-prone skin because it unclogs pores from within. The formula also includes calming ingredients like calendula, chamomile, and allantoin to prevent the irritation that can worsen breakouts. It cleanses thoroughly without disrupting your skin's natural barrier.
